SCDF’s Response to Media Queries on the Charging of SCDF Officers in Relation to the Death of NSF CPL Kok Yuen Chin
25 July 2018

In response to media queries, the Singapore Civil Defence Force (SCDF) confirms that eight SCDF officers have been referred by the Singapore Police Force to SCDF for departmental investigation. Six of them are regular officers and two are Full-Time National Servicemen (NSFs). If investigations find that they had contravened SCDF rules and regulations, the regular officers will face public service disciplinary actions, which may include dismissal from service or demotion in rank, while the NSFs will be liable for detention and/or demotion in rank under the Civil Defence Act.


SCDF takes a zero-tolerance stance towards ragging. We will take firm action against any officer found to be involved in such activities.
